The position being recruited for is within the Forensic Program which consists of a Secure Forensic Service, a General Forensic Service, and a Forensic Outpatient Service. The Secure Forensic Service, which consists of 3 units providing assessment, treatment and rehabilitation services for patients who are ordered by the courts or the Ontario Review Board (ORB) and who require accommodation at a higher security level. The General Forensic Service, which consists of two units, providing assessment, treatment and rehabilitation services for patients who are ordered by courts or Ontario Review Board (ORB) and who require accommodation at a lower security level. The Forensic Outpatient Service provides assessment, treatment and rehabilitation services for patients who are ordered by the courts or the Ontario Review Board (ORB) who reside in the community.
